Aspects Affecting French Door Installation Prices

When estimating the price of installing French doors, a number of factors enter into play:

  1. Type of French Doors: There are multiple styles, including traditional wood, fiberglass, and aluminum. Each material features a various price point.
  2. Size: Standard size doors vary in price from custom sizes.
  3. Installation Complexity: If structural modifications are necessary, such as increasing the size of the opening or strengthening the frame, costs will increase.
  4. Labor Costs: Installation costs vary by region and the experience level of the contractor.
  5. Additional Features: Options like energy-efficient glass, security locks, and ornamental hardware can add to the overall cost.
  6. Location: Depending on the geographical area, costs for products and labor can fluctuate.

Average Costs for French Door Installation

To give you a clearer image of the expenses, we've assembled the typical prices for different types of French doors, consisting of materials, labor, and additional costs.

Cost Breakdown Table

ProductLow-End EstimateHigh-End Estimate
Product Costs
Wood (Solid)₤ 1,000₤ 3,500
Fiberglass₤ 900₤ 2,500
Aluminum₤ 1,200₤ 3,000
Labor Costs
Installation Fees₤ 300₤ 800
Additional Features
Energy-efficient glass₤ 200₤ 500
Custom Hardware₤ 100₤ 300
Overall Estimated Costs₤ 1,600₤ 5,000

Elements of Installation Costs

1. Material Costs

  • Wood Doors: Known for their timeless appearance, wood doors can vary considerably in price depending on the type of wood and finish.
  • Fiberglass Doors: More resilient and resistant to weather modifications, these doors usually cost less than wood however offer similar aesthetic appeal.
  • Aluminum Doors: Lightweight and flexible, aluminum doors can be a great choice for modern homes, but they may not provide the exact same insulation as wood or fiberglass.

2. Labor Costs

Labor expenses can differ based on geographic location and the contractor's experience. Usually, homeowners ought to an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 300 to ₤ 800 for installation.

3. Additional Features

Investing in energy-efficient glass can save money on heating and cooling bills in the long run. Custom hardware alternatives likewise include to the cost but can drastically enhance the general appearance of the doors.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: How long does it take to install French doors?

A1: The installation of French doors typically takes in between 4 to 6 hours, depending upon the complexity of the task and whether any structural modifications are required.

Q2: Are French doors worth the cost?

A2: Yes, French doors can improve the visual appeal of your home, improve natural light, and enhance residential or commercial property worth. The financial investment can settle in regards to energy efficiency and roi when selling your home.

Q3: Can I install French doors myself?

A3: If you have enough carpentry experience and the right tools, DIY installation is possible. Nevertheless, it's suggested to seek advice from a professional if you are unsure about any elements of the installation.

Q4: How do I keep my French doors?

A4: Regular cleansing, inspecting and replacing weather removing, and painting or staining wood doors every couple of years are vital for keeping French doors.
